在一些特殊情况下,我们会自定义一些MapReduce中的组件来满足自己的需求,比如自定义的Partition就是很好的例子。 1.1  自定义InputFormat在Hadoop系统中自带了一些常用的InputFormat,我们可直接使用,如下:FileInputFormat<K,V>这个是基本的文件输入父类。TextInputFormat<LongWrit
在伪分布式下,按照下面两个博客,分别以命令行方式和Eclipse执行WordCount程序时,都会出现同样的错误,(Eclipse:)(命令行方式:)错误描述为:Exception in thread "main" org.apache.hadoop.mapreduce.lib.input.InvalidInputException: Input path does not exist: hdfs
Sqoop一.Sqoop1.Sqoop是什么2.RDB导入数据到HDFS2.1导入表到HDFS2.2通过Where语句过滤导入表2.3通过COLUMNS过滤导入表2.4使用query方式导入数据2.5使用Sqoop增量导入数据2.6导入时指定文件格式参数3.sqoop job3.1sqoop作用3.2相关命令3.3示例4.从RDB导入数据到Hive4.1直接导入数据到Hive4.2导入数据到Hi
转载 9月前
30阅读
InputFormat数据输入一、切片与MapTask并行度决定机制MapReduce的数据流为:MapTask的并行度决定Map阶段的任务处理并发度,进而影响到整个Job的处理速度。InputFormat会在数据提交前对数据进行切片处理。**数据块:**Block是HDFS物理上把数据分成一块一块。**数据切片:**数据切片只是在逻辑上对输入进行分片,并不会在磁盘上将其切分成片进行存储。不同的I
# 如何将Java文件输出到本地 作为一名经验丰富的开发者,我将会教会你如何将Java文件输出到本地。这是一个非常简单的任务,只需要几个简单的步骤就可以完成。在开始之前,确保你已经安装了Java开发环境。 ## 步骤概览 下面是将Java文件输出到本地的步骤概览。我们将使用Java标准库中的`FileOutputStream`类来完成这个任务。 | 步骤 | 描述 | | ---- | -
原创 2024-01-21 08:36:08
33阅读
# Java文件输出到本地 在Java编程中,我们经常需要将数据输出到文件中,然后保存在本地。这在大数据处理、日志记录等方面非常常见。本文将介绍如何使用Java的File类来实现文件输出到本地的操作,并提供相应的代码示例。 ## File类概述 在Java中,File类是用于操作文件和目录路径的实用工具。它提供了用于创建、删除、重命名、复制、移动等操作的方法。 为了使用File类,我们首先
原创 2023-11-19 13:41:51
99阅读
# Java输出到本地目录 在Java开发中,我们经常需要将程序运行的结果输出到本地目录中,以便于后续的处理或查看。本文将介绍如何使用Java代码实现输出到本地目录的功能,并提供相关示例代码。 ## 1. 使用FileOutputStream实现文件输出 Java中的FileOutputStream类可以用来创建文件并将数据输出到文件中。下面是一个简单的示例代码,演示了如何通过FileOut
原创 2023-09-28 01:37:39
163阅读
# Java bufferedImage输出到本地 在Java中,BufferedImage是一个用来表示图像数据的类,它提供了一系列的方法来处理和操作图像。当我们需要将一个BufferedImage保存到本地文件中时,我们可以使用ImageIO类提供的方法来实现。 ## BufferedImage的基本概念和用法 BufferedImage是Java中用来表示图像数据的一个类,它继承自ja
原创 2024-01-08 07:20:16
899阅读
基本概念Hadoop:的框架最核心的设计就是:HDFS和MapReduce。HDFS为海量的数据提供了存储,则MapReduce为海量的数据提供了计算。 MapReduce:是处理大量半结构化数据集合的编程模型。最简单的 MapReduce应用程序至少包含 3 个部分:一个 Map 函数、一个 Reduce 函数和一个 main 函数。我的简单理解是map按照一定规则对输入做一系列的处理,redu
转载 2023-07-12 02:31:59
130阅读
1.注意问题: 1.在开发过程中一定要导入hbase源码中的lib库否则出现如下错误 TableMapReducUtil 找不到什么…… 2.编码: import java.io.IOException; import java.text.ParseException; import java.text.SimpleDateFormat; import java.util.Date; impor...
原创 2021-07-29 10:38:41
196阅读
# Hive 查询数据输出到本地 ## 1. 介绍 Apache Hive是一个建立在Hadoop上的数据仓库工具,它提供了类似SQL的接口来查询和分析数据。在Hive中,我们可以执行SQL查询来提取所需的数据,然后将结果输出到本地文件系统中进行进一步处理或分析。 在本文中,我们将介绍如何使用Hive查询数据并将结果输出到本地文件系统,同时提供代码示例来帮助读者更好地理解这个过程。 ##
原创 2024-06-14 06:06:55
37阅读
# Java将文件输出到本地 Java是一种广泛应用于开发各种应用程序的编程语言。在Java中,我们可以使用FileOutputStream类将文件输出到本地。本文将介绍如何使用Java将文件输出到本地,并提供相应的代码示例。 ## 文件输出的基本概念 在Java中,文件输出指的是将数据从内存写入到磁盘文件中。文件输出是将数据持久化的一种方式,可以保存数据供以后使用。Java提供了多种用于文
原创 2023-12-30 08:20:18
162阅读
在Java开发中,使用`XSSFWorkbook`将Excel文件导出到本地是一个常见的需求。通过本博文,我们将细致地探讨这个过程,分析适用场景,比较不同架构,拆解特性,进行实战对比,深入原理,给出选型指南。 ## 背景定位 在数据导出需求日益增加的今天,很多企业需要将数据报告生成为Excel格式,以便于用户查看与分析。尤其在财务、统计和数据分析等领域,灵活地生成Excel文件成为了工作流程中
原创 5月前
115阅读
# 实现“redis查询结果输出到本地”步骤 ## 流程图 ```mermaid flowchart TD A[连接到Redis数据库] --> B[查询数据] B --> C[将查询结果输出到本地] ``` ## 步骤说明 1. **连接到Redis数据库** - 使用redis-py库来连接到Redis数据库,代码如下: ```python i
原创 2024-03-15 05:57:18
41阅读
# Java依赖树输出到本地 在Java开发中,我们经常会使用依赖管理工具来管理项目中的依赖关系,比如Maven或者Gradle。这些工具可以帮助我们自动管理项目中的依赖,并且在构建过程中自动下载所需的依赖jar包。但有时候,我们可能需要将项目中的依赖树输出到本地文件,以便于分析、备份或者分享依赖信息。本文将介绍如何使用Maven插件将项目的依赖树输出到本地文件中。 ## 为什么需要输出依赖树
原创 2024-06-02 04:07:08
282阅读
实现将Docker容器日志输出到本地的过程可以分为以下几个步骤: 1. 在Docker容器中安装并配置日志驱动程序 2. 创建本地日志目录 3. 配置Docker容器以将日志输出到本地目录 4. 验证日志输出 下面将逐步详细介绍每个步骤需要进行的操作和相关代码。 ### 1. 在Docker容器中安装并配置日志驱动程序 首先,我们需要在Docker容器中安装并配置适当的日志驱动程序,以便将
原创 2024-01-01 06:41:06
490阅读
# Java把文件输出到本地 在Java编程中,我们经常需要将一些数据保存到文件中,并将其输出到本地磁盘上。本文将介绍如何使用Java代码将文件输出到本地,并提供相应的代码示例。在本文中,我们将使用Java的FileOutputStream类来实现文件输出。 ## FileOutputStream类简介 在Java中,FileOutputStream类用于将数据写入文件。它是OutputSt
原创 2023-11-28 07:22:47
126阅读
# 如何使用Java将JSON输出到本地 ## 简介 在本文中,我将教你如何使用Java将JSON数据输出到本地文件。作为一名经验丰富的开发者,我将向你展示整个过程,并提供详细的代码示例和解释。 ## 流程步骤 下面是实现“Java 将JSON输出到本地”这一任务的流程步骤: | 步骤 | 描述 | | --- | --- | | 1 | 创建JSON数据 | | 2 | 将JSON数据写入
原创 2024-02-25 03:38:13
146阅读
# 如何将Java List输出到本地文件 ## 目录 - [引言](#引言) - [实现步骤](#实现步骤) - [代码示例](#代码示例) - [总结](#总结) ## 引言 在Java开发中,经常会遇到将数据输出到本地文件的需求。本篇文章将教会你如何将Java List输出到本地文件。我们将一步一步地介绍整个实现过程。 ## 实现步骤 为了方便理解,我们将整个实现过程分为以下几个步骤,
原创 2023-10-17 11:20:51
48阅读
## Python 连续记录输出到本地 在日常编程中,我们经常需要将程序的输出结果保存到本地文件中,以便后续分析和查看。Python 提供了各种方法来实现将程序的输出内容连续记录到本地文件的功能。本文将介绍如何使用 Python 实现连续记录输出到本地的方法,并提供相应的代码示例。 ### 准备工作 在开始编写代码之前,我们需要先创建一个用于保存输出内容的文件。可以使用 Python 的内置
原创 2024-01-21 11:10:02
28阅读
  • 1
  • 2
  • 3
  • 4
  • 5